@retardeddude0000 Power-over is a technique to initiate oversteer. The other initiating techniques are shift lock, clutch kick, hand brake, feint (a.k.a. Scandinavian flick), and inertia drift.
Since he was not oversteering when he entered the turn, it's not a drift. This is a powerslide.
@ph13rwun I had thought that powersliding was using the momentum of the car to break the grip on the rear wheels causing the car to slide out of its line. Is that what was done here?
@retardeddude0000 No, he seems to be using clutch kick to break the wheels loose. With a clutch kick you push in the clutch, rev the engine up and let the clutch out quickly.
Using the momentum of the car to oversteer is what is done with a feint drift. Before the entry point you steer away from the corner and quickly steer into the corner. Inertia drift uses the momentum of the car as well, but you use the brakes to shift the weight of the car forward and then steer into the corner.
